COMSafeArray.GetUpperBound (COMSafeArray.GetUpperBound)

COMSafeArray (COMSafeArray)

GetUpperBound (GetUpperBound)

Доступен, начиная с версии 8.0.

Синтаксис:

GetUpperBound(<НомерИзмерения>)

Параметры:

<НомерИзмерения> (необязательный)

Тип: Число.
Измерения в массиве нумеруются с нуля от старшего к младшему.
Значение по умолчанию: 0.

Возвращаемое значение:

Тип: Число.

Описание:

Получает максимальное значение индекса для данного измерения массива.

Доступность:

Сервер, толстый клиент, внешнее соединение.

Примечание:

Если указанный в параметре номер измерения меньше 0 или больше номера максимального измерения, то никаких действий не производится и выдается сообщение "Значение индекса выходит за границы диапазона".

Пример:

ИндексМин = Массив.GetLowerBound(0);
ИндексМакс = Массив.GetUpperBound(0);
Для 
Индекс = ИндексМин по ИндексМакс Цикл
    ЭлементМассива = Массив.GetValue(Индекс);
КонецЦикла
;

Использование в версии:

Доступен, начиная с версии 8.0.


     Методическая информация